What is a fiber optics engineer?

A Fiber Optics Engineer designs, installs, and maintains fiber optic communication systems. They work with high-speed data transmission networks, ensuring efficient signal transmission through optical fibers. Their responsibilities include testing fiber connections, troubleshooting issues, and optimizing network performance. They may collaborate with other engineers to expand fiber networks and ensure reliability. This role is essential for telecommunications, internet services, and data infrastructure.

What are the typical daily responsibilities of a fiber optics engineer?

Fiber Optics Engineers typically spend their days designing fiber optic network layouts, conducting site surveys, and overseeing the installation and testing of fiber cables. Tasks often include troubleshooting signal issues, preparing technical documentation, and using specialized equipment to certify network performance. You’ll regularly collaborate with project managers, field technicians, and network architects to ensure projects are delivered on time and meet quality standards. This hands-on and collaborative environment provides a mix of technical problem-solving and teamwork, making each day varied and engaging.

What are the key skills and qualifications needed to thrive in the fiber optics engineer position, and why are they important?

To thrive as a Fiber Optics Engineer, you need a strong background in optical engineering, telecommunications, and network design, typically supported by a degree in electrical engineering or a related field. Familiarity with tools like OTDRs (Optical Time Domain Reflectometers), splicing machines, AutoCAD, and industry certifications such as FOA or CFOT is highly beneficial. Effective problem-solving, attention to detail, and strong communication skills set candidates apart in this position. These capabilities are essential for designing, maintaining, and optimizing high-performing fiber optic networks while coordinating with cross-functional teams.

Job description

Looking for Fiber Optic/ Cabling Techs from Telecom background in the FAYETTEVILLE, AR  Area.

Job Description:

  • The OSP Fielder primarily deals with gathering the necessary field information on the existing aerial and underground infrastructure (Poles, pole loading, Cables, terminal cabinets GPS coordinates etc. for the engineers to use in the design phase
  • Locate and document detailed information on the existing OSP facilities : cables, poles, ground structures, terminals, manholes, and equipment using a specialized I-Pad application
  • Acquire the necessary field information, record verification's, document preparation, required to prepare work order construction prints
  • You ll take detailed, measurements, notes, and photos of the proposed telecommunications network construction locations, cable routes, and equipment and complete field surveys, ROW (right of way) drawings, asset documentation, etc to determine best routes for the Fiber construction
